Transaction 65484cea9df58059589c4243a1f79ebbe4ee91e22cfb262f4dd8cbb80a6896e2
1 Input
1 Output
-
65484cea9df58059589c4243a1f79ebbe4ee91e22cfb262f4dd8cbb80a6896e2:0
- value
- 509611
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75234182744481955880819523e3600e15fa1641 OP_EQUAL
- address
- 3CNPDcNCynVaPtQPJyJ7ZMB8Jqgzu7fZFr